Ridgemont Equity Partners; Company type: Private: Industry: Private equity: Predecessor: BAML Capital Partners (2009-10), Bank of America Capital Investors (1993-2009), Merrill Lynch Global Private Equity (1996-2009) Founded: 1993 (predecessor) 2010 (spinout) Headquarters: Charlotte, North Carolina, United States: Total assets: US$5 billion
Pretium was formed in 2012 by Donald Mullen who was a Partner at Goldman Sachs. [2] [4] [5] [6] Mullen was the head of Goldman Sachs’ mortgage and credit business and was one of the main architects behind the bet against the U.S. housing market in what became known as "The Big Short."

Clayton, Dubilier & Rice, LLC (CD&R) [1] is an American private equity company. CD&R is the 24th oldest Private Equity firm in the world. CD&R has managed the investment of more than $30 billion in approximately 90 businesses, representing a broad range of industries with an aggregate transaction value in excess of $140 billion.

Capital Bank Financial Corporation was a bank holding company head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, [1] with $10 billion in assets as of first quarter 2017 and 193 branches.
